Molecular Medicine Program
Molecular Medicine Program’s vision is to bring together research scientists from disparate clinical disciplines working on projects in translational medicine to promote cross-pollination of ideas, catalyze collaborations and discovery, and train the next generation of biomedical scientists.
The University of Utah Molecular Medicine Program (U2M2) is the key multidepartmental and interdisciplinary engine for clinical departments. U2M2 investigators have primary appointments in clinical departments and lead research programs that advance translational science by catalyzing the development, testing, and implementation of new diagnostics and therapeutics for a variety of human diseases and conditions.
Our Program encompasses a broad range of departments within the School of Medicine, and College of Health. Investigators are housed in Eccles Institute of Human Genetics (EIHG), Wintrobe Research Building, and the Cardiovascular Research & Training Institute (CVRTI).
